## Authentication — Nightly Reindex (Searchloom)

The nightly reindex job authenticates to the Searchloom indexing tier as the `reindex-runner` service identity. Before intervening manually, confirm the job's last successful run in the scheduler dashboard, since re-running against a partially built index can double-count documents. Manual invocations must pass the same identity the scheduler uses; interactive user tokens are rejected by design. When running the job by hand from the ops bastion, authenticate with the key below.

gateway credential: kto23_LX9A4ys6i4nzHtpOLNLodKK

**Mgmt Meeting Minutes — Retiring the Brightline Range**

Quick recap for sales leads at Fenholt Supplies: we agreed to retire the Brightline fixture range by year-end. Remaining stock moves to clearance pricing next month, and accounts on standing orders get migrated to the Lumetta range. Trade-in incentives were approved in principle. The confidential note on next steps sits just below.

board note of bajof-bajeg: The pricing group signed off on a budget of $13.4 million for Project Sildor. The renewal with Lamixek Holdings closes at $48.9 million a year, 49 percent above the last contract.

## Support

Sockpress trades CPU for bandwidth: permessage-deflate is enabled by default on the Relayline gateway. Under load, disable compression per-route before scaling out — it's usually the cheaper fix. Metrics to watch: `ws_compress_cpu` and `ws_frame_bytes`. Runbook section 4 covers toggles. For tradeoff decisions you can't resolve on shift, escalate to the gateway team at the address below.

escalation mailbox, yajeg-bageg: quenax.olidor@lumiccorp.internal

Digest batching for Plumereach runs every four hours via the Quillstack scheduler. Each batch is signed before handoff to the relay tier, and failed sends are quarantined rather than retried, which limits replay exposure. Schedule changes require a two-person approval in the config repo. The current cron definitions, signing key rotation policy, and audit log locations are documented on the internal scheduling page.

operations page: https://confluence.nelvroworks.example/dash/spaces/board/job/pipeline/issue/spaces/b9c0f0fbc164027c4eb481af